This oversight is a ticking time bomb.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>The Walkaway Problem:<\/strong> If a co-founder leaves after two months taking 50% of the equity with them, remaining founders are left paralyzed and resentful.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Lack of Vesting:<\/strong> Standard time-based or milestone-based vesting protects the company by ensuring equity is earned incrementally over time.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Undefined Roles and Responsibilities:<\/strong> Generic incorporation documents rarely specify decision-making authority or deadlock-breaking mechanisms.<\/li>\n<li><strong>IP Ownership Gaps:<\/strong> Without explicit assignment agreements, departing co-founders might legally retain ownership of the core code or brand assets they created.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Loss of Investor Appeal:<\/strong> Venture capitalists routinely refuse to fund companies where early equity is improperly distributed or unvested.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Intellectual Property (IP) Leaks: Giving Away the Farm Before You Grow \ud83e\udde0<\/h2>\n<p>Your startup&#8217;s true value lies in its intellectual property\u2014whether it&#8217;s proprietary software algorithms, unique designs, or proprietary databases. Many founders mistakenly believe that forming a company automatically transfers their personal IP assets into the corporate entity. Engaging in <strong>DIY startup incorporation<\/strong> without executing bulletproof Proprietary Information and Inventions Agreements (PIIAs) creates massive vulnerabilities.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Personal Retention of Assets:<\/strong> Code written before the official incorporation date might legally belong to the individual, not the startup.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Contractor Loopholes:<\/strong> Hiring freelance developers without strict &#8220;work-made-for-hire&#8221; clauses can result in third parties owning vital parts of your tech stack.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Due Diligence Red Flags:<\/strong> During an acquisition or funding round, messy IP chains of title will immediately halt or kill the deal.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Competitor Exploitation:<\/strong> Failing to properly secure trademarks and patents early on allows competitors to legally copy your unique market positioning.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Open Source Complications:<\/strong> Careless integration of external libraries without checking licensing compliance can force proprietary code into the public domain.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Tax Traps and Regulatory Nightmares: Choosing the Wrong Entity Structure \ud83d\udcca<\/h2>\n<p>The alphabet soup of business structures\u2014LLC, S-Corp, C-Corp\u2014confuses even seasoned business owners. Choosing the wrong classification during a <strong>DIY startup incorporation<\/strong> process can result in thousands of dollars in overpaid taxes or unexpected regulatory burdens. Online self-service wizards often push generic recommendations without evaluating your unique business model or fundraising trajectory.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>The C-Corp vs. LLC Dilemma:<\/strong> Setting up an LLC when you plan to raise venture capital forces an expensive and complex corporate conversion later.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Double Taxation Traps:<\/strong> Certain corporate structures inadvertently subject business earnings to corporate-level and personal-level income tax.<\/li>\n<li><strong>State-Specific Franchise Taxes:<\/strong> States like Delaware or California impose hefty minimum franchise taxes even if your startup generates zero revenue.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Failure to File 83(b) Elections:<\/strong> Missing the strict 30-day IRS window for an 83(b) election can result in founders paying massive income taxes on worthless founder stock.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Foreign Qualification Fines:<\/strong> Operating in a state other than your state of incorporation without registering locally triggers severe fines and loss of court access.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Piercing the Corporate Veil: Why Personal Asset Protection Fails \ud83d\udee1\ufe0f<\/h2>\n<p>The primary reason entrepreneurs form corporations or LLCs is to shield their personal assets\u2014homes, savings accounts, cars\u2014from business liabilities. However, courts can &#8220;pierce the corporate veil&#8221; and hold founders personally liable if the company is not treated as a distinct legal entity. <strong>DIY startup incorporation<\/strong> often leaves founders completely in the dark regarding ongoing corporate formalities.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Commingling Funds:<\/strong> Depositing customer revenue into personal bank accounts or paying personal grocery bills from company funds obliterates liability protection.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Missing Corporate Minutes:<\/strong> Failing to hold annual meetings and document major business decisions signals to courts that the corporation is a sham.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Inadequate Capitalization:<\/strong> Launching a high-risk business with zero operational capital from the start can be used by plaintiffs to bypass corporate shields.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Unsigned Contracts:<\/strong> Signing agreements in your personal name rather than as an authorized corporate officer binds you directly to the liability.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Lack of Separate Branding:<\/strong> Failing to consistently use your official corporate suffix on invoices, websites, and marketing materials weakens your legal standing.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>FAQ \u2753<\/h2>\n<p><strong>Q1: Is DIY startup incorporation ever a safe option for early-stage founders?<\/strong><br \/>\n    A1: <strong>DIY startup incorporation<\/strong> can sometimes work for simple, single-owner lifestyle businesses or low-risk freelance operations where no outside capital or co-founders are involved. Always consult with a qualified corporate attorney for high-growth ventures.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Q2: What is an 83(b) election, and why is missing it so dangerous for startup founders?<\/strong><br \/>\n    A2: An 83(b) election is a notification sent to the IRS within 30 days of receiving restricted stock, allowing founders to pay income taxes on the current, nominal value of the shares rather than their future, potentially skyrocketing worth. If you miss this strict 30-day deadline due to poor guidance during a <strong>DIY startup incorporation<\/strong> process, you could face a crippling tax bill on paper wealth before your company even generates a profit.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Q3: How can I ensure my website and digital infrastructure comply with legal standards?<\/strong><br \/>\n    A3: Beyond proper corporate formation, your digital footprint requires comprehensive Terms of Service, a robust Privacy Policy, and GDPR\/CCPA compliance measures.
